Bringing Sensory Support Into the Community

Sunshine Physical Therapy Clinic is proud to offer one of the only mobile sensory environments of its kind in Florida. The Traveling Sadlek Sensorium brings therapeutic tools and sensory experiences to community settings, helping individuals of all ages regulate, engage, and feel supported—wherever they are. Funded by Head, Heart, and Hands of Indian River Club, this resource extends the reach of our care beyond clinic walls.

Supporting Sensory, Cognitive, and Emotional Wellness

The Traveling Sensorium offers a calming, multi-sensory experience designed to improve focus, reduce overwhelm, and support regulation. This environment supports individuals with sensory processing disorders, ADHD, autism, cognitive decline, and more—helping them better participate in learning, therapy, and daily life.

Where We Travel

Retirement communities and assisted living


Providing cognitive and sensory stimulation for older adults, including those with dementia.

Community events and outreach programs


Offering a hands-on way to educate and support local families and providers.

Childcare centers and schools


Supporting learning and behavior regulation in early childhood and school-aged settings.

Commonly Asked Questions

  • What is a Sensorium?

    A Sensorium is a multi-sensory space designed to help individuals process sensory input and support emotional and physical regulation.

  • Who benefits from the Traveling Sensorium?

    It’s ideal for children and adults with sensory processing challenges, behavioral needs, or cognitive impairments such as dementia or ADHD.

  • Where can the Sensorium travel?

    We bring it to schools, early learning centers, senior communities, public events, and more.
